1. Technical Specifications and Performance Metrics

For effective procurement, the primary decision point is the ball size, which dictates the performance envelope and intended user demographic. The procurement must align with specific dimensional and physical tolerances to ensure regulatory compliance and gameplay consistency.

  • Ball Size 7 (Men's Competition):
    • Circumference: 749–780 mm
    • Weight: 567–650 g
    • Inflation Pressure: 0.55–0.65 bar
    • Rebound Performance: 1200–1400 mm rebound height when dropped from 1800 mm.
    • Material Recommendation: Composite leather with a butyl bladder is the industry standard for balancing grip, durability, and air retention.
  • Ball Size 6 (Women's/Youth Competition):
    • Circumference: 699–710 mm
    • Weight: 510–567 g
    • Material Recommendation: Same composite leather and butyl bladder construction as Size 7 for consistency in feel.
  • Backboard and Structure Specifications:
    • Backboard Height: 2900 mm ± 30 mm (unless adjustable).
    • Face of Backboard Location: 1.2 m from the end line.
    • Minimum Clear Space: 1800 mm wide × 1050 mm high for the immediate playing area.

Procurement Recommendation: Verify that all incoming inventory includes a test report confirming the rebound height falls within the 1200–1400 mm range for Size 7 balls. For structural equipment, strictly enforce the 2900 mm ± 30 mm height tolerance to prevent regulatory rejection during court certification.

2. Industry Compliance and Quality Assurance

Compliance is non-negotiable for institutional and professional procurement. The supply chain must provide verifiable documentation to satisfy engineering and safety standards.

  • Certification Requirements: All basketball backboard structures must be certified by a Registered Professional Engineer of Queensland (RPEQ). This certification must be supported by test results supplied directly by the manufacturer or supplier.
  • Documentation Standards: Equipment must be permanently marked with the manufacturer's name, model number, and installation date.
  • Technical Note Compliance: Procurement contracts must reference "Technical Note: Basketball equipment specification | Version 2.0," specifically Schedule B regarding construction documentation.
  • Structural Integrity: Any backboard structures with shorter supporting arms than the certified model must undergo specific re-evaluation or be deemed non-compliant unless explicitly covered by the manufacturer's test data.

Procurement Recommendation: Do not accept "standard" warranties as proof of compliance. Require the RPEQ certificate and the specific test results referenced in the technical note as a condition precedent for payment. Ensure the supplier provides the installation design certification number and date before delivery.

3. Cost Efficiency and Integration Capabilities

While exact market pricing is not provided in the source data, B2B procurement strategies should focus on lifecycle costs and integration efficiency rather than just unit price.

  • Typical B2B Unit Cost Ranges:
    • Competition Balls (Size 7): Typically range from $45–$75 USD per unit for bulk orders (MOQ 10+).
    • Youth Balls (Size 6): Typically range from $35–$55 USD per unit.
    • Structural Backboards: Costs vary significantly based on material (tempered glass vs. acrylic) and mounting system, typically ranging from $1,500–$4,000 USD per unit for commercial grade.
  • Lead Time: Standard lead time for balls is 2–4 weeks; structural components often require 6–10 weeks due to engineering certification and fabrication.
  • Integration: Equipment must be compatible with existing court markings and lighting. The 1.2 m setback from the end line is a critical integration constraint for new court installations.

Procurement Recommendation: Prioritize suppliers who offer "turnkey" solutions where the RPEQ certification is bundled with the delivery of the backboard structure. This reduces administrative overhead and ensures that the installation date is recorded correctly on the equipment, satisfying the "General Equipment" compliance clause.

4. Typical Use Cases

Understanding the specific application scenario ensures the correct specification is selected, preventing performance failures.

  • Professional & High School Men's Leagues: Requires Size 7 balls with composite leather and butyl bladders. Backboards must be rigid, meeting the 2900 mm height standard.
  • Women's Leagues & Youth Academies: Requires Size 6 balls. Durability is key for high-volume training sessions.
  • School and Community Courts: Requires robust backboard structures that can withstand frequent use. The 1800 mm × 1050 mm minimum clear space is essential for safety in multi-purpose facilities.
  • Training Facilities: High-volume usage demands balls with superior air retention (butyl bladder) to reduce maintenance frequency.

Procurement Recommendation: For schools and community centers, procure a mixed inventory: 70% Size 7 for general use and 30% Size 6 for youth programs. For backboards, select models with the RPEQ certification already attached to the design phase to avoid retrofitting costs.

5. Long-Term Planning Considerations

Strategic procurement must account for market trends and regulatory evolution.

  • Market Trends: There is a growing demand for "smart" basketballs with embedded sensors for performance tracking, though this is currently a niche B2B segment. The shift toward composite leather over genuine leather is accelerating due to durability and cost-efficiency.
  • Regulatory Signals: The emphasis on RPEQ certification suggests a tightening of safety regulations for public infrastructure. Future tenders may require digital logging of installation dates and real-time structural monitoring.
  • Durability Planning: Composite leather balls typically last 12–18 months in high-traffic environments, whereas genuine leather may require more frequent replacement but offers superior grip initially.
  • Sustainability: Look for suppliers using recycled materials in the rubber bladder and packaging to align with corporate ESG goals.

Procurement Recommendation: Establish a 3-year replacement cycle for balls based on the 12–18 month durability estimate. For structural equipment, plan for a 10-year lifecycle, ensuring the supplier has a long-term support agreement for RPEQ re-certification if regulations change.

7. Frequently Asked Questions (FAQ)

Q1: What is the minimum circumference required for a men's competition basketball? A: The circumference must fall within the range of 749 mm to 780 mm.

Q2: Is a Registered Professional Engineer of Queensland (RPEQ) certification required for basketball backboards? A: Yes, all basketball backboard structures must be certified by an RPEQ, supported by manufacturer test results, to comply with the technical specification.

Q3: What is the standard inflation pressure for a Size 7 ball? A: The standard inflation pressure is between 0.55 and 0.65 bar.

Q4: How far from the end line should the face of the backboard be located? A: The face of the backboard must be located 1.2 meters from the end line.

Q5: What material is recommended for the best balance of grip and durability? A: Composite leather with a butyl bladder is recommended for the best balance of grip, durability, and air retention.

Q6: What are the weight specifications for a Size 6 basketball? A: A Size 6 ball should weigh between 510 g and 567 g.

Q7: What is the required backboard height for a standard installation? A: The backboard height should be 2900 mm ± 30 mm, unless the system is adjustable.

Q8: What documentation must be marked on the equipment upon supply? A: Equipment must be marked with the manufacturer's name, model number, and the installation date.
